1.2.3 Positioning the TV

Carefully read the safety precautions before positioning the TV.
• Position the TV where light does not shine directly on the screen.
• Dim lighting conditions in the room for best Ambilight effect.
• Position the TV up to 25 cm away from the wall for the best
Ambilight effect.
Position the TV at the ideal viewing distance. Get more from HD TV
picture or any picture without straining your eyes. Find the 'sweet spot',
right in front of the TV, for the best possible TV experience and relaxed
viewing.
The ideal distance to watch TV from is three times its diagonal
screen size. When seated, your eyes should be level with the centre
of the screen.
1.2.4 Safety and care
Make sure you have read and understood all instructions before
using your TV. The warranty becomes invalid if any damage is caused
by failure to follow instructions.
Risk of electric shock or fire!
• Never expose the TV or remote control to rain, water or

excessive heat.
• Never place liquid containers, such as vases, near the TV. If liquids
are spilt on or into the TV, disconnect the TV from the power outlet
immediately. Contact Philips Consumer Care to have the TV
checked before use.
• Never place the TV, remote control or batteries near naked
flames or other heat sources, including direct sunlight.
• Keep candles and other naked flames away from this product at
all times.
• Never insert objects into the ventilation slots or other openings
on the TV.
• Ensure power plugs do not come under heavy force. Loose
power plugs can cause arcing and are a fire hazard.
• Never place the TV or any objects on the power cord.
• When disconnecting the power cord, always pull the plug, never
the cord.
Risk of injury or damage to the TV!
• Two people are required to lift and carry a TV that weighs more
than 25 kg.
• If you mount the TV on a stand, only use the supplied stand.
Secure the stand to the TV tightly. Place the TV on a flat, level
surface that can support the weight of the TV.
• When mounting the TV on a wall, ensure that the wall mount can
safely bear the weight of the TV set. Koninklijke Philips Electronics
N.V. bears no responsibility for improper wall mounting that results
in accident, injury or damage.
Risk of injury to children!
Follow these precautions to prevent the TV from toppling over and
causing injury to children:
• Never place the TV on a surface covered by a cloth or other
material that can be pulled away.
• Ensure that no part of the TV hangs over the edge of the
mounting surface.
• Never place the TV on tall furniture, such as a bookcase, without
anchoring both the furniture and TV to the wall or a suitable
support.
• Educate children about the dangers of climbing on furniture to
reach the TV.
Risk of overheating!
Always leave a space of at least 10 cm around the TV for
ventilation. Ensure curtains or other objects never cover the
ventilation slots on the TV.
Lightning storms
Disconnect the TV from the power outlet and antenna before
lightning storms. During lightning storms, never touch any part of
the TV, power cord or antenna cable.
Risk of hearing damage!
Avoid using earphones or headphones at high volumes or for
prolonged periods of time.
Low temperatures
If the TV is transported in temperatures below 5°C, unpack the TV
and wait until the TV temperature reaches room temperature
before connecting the TV to the mains.
• Risk of damage to the TV screen! Never touch, push, rub or strike
the screen with any object.
• Unplug the TV before cleaning.
